Overview

As consumer product portfolios grow in scale and complexity, we are strengthening our Consumer Product Quality Assurance (CPQA) capabilities to ensure strong product performance and quality system oversight in real‑world use.

Product complaints are a critical, regulated source of customer and patient feedback, enabling early signal detection, risk identification, and continuous improvement across the product lifecycle.

This role reports to the Associate Vice President of End‑to‑End Product Complaints and leads the transformation of reporting and analytics that convert complaint and quality data into validated, decision‑ready insights. The role supports global complaint management by enabling the analysis and interpretation of product complaint data, driving quality, compliance, and process improvements across the enterprise.

Organization Overview

The Consumer Product Quality Assurance – Reporting & Insights Lead is a core role within the Global Product Complaints organization, responsible for advancing reporting and analytics capabilities that support the end‑to‑end product complaints quality system.

The role primarily serves CPQA and the global complaint management system, while supporting a broader network of thousands of stakeholders globally, including manufacturing sites, affiliates, call centers, and cross‑functional partners.

Working in close partnership with the Global Quality Transformation Office and Tech@Lilly, this role ensures that data, reporting, and analytics solutions are scalable, efficient, aligned to enterprise platforms and standards, and meet the needs of a complex, global quality ecosystem.
